  • Patent number: 4194812
    Abstract: An electrochromic device comprises an electrochromic layer comprising a transition metal compound sandwiched in between a first auxiliary electrochromic layer and a second auxiliary electrochromic layer, each of the auxiliary electrochromic layers comprising at least one metal compound containing at least one metal different from the metal in the transition metal compound in the electrochromic layer, and the difference in electro-negativity between both metals being not more than 0.4.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: July 2, 1976
    Date of Patent: March 25, 1980
    Assignee: Canon Kabushiki Kaisha Toshitama Hara
    Inventors: Toshitami Hara, Yoshioki Hajimoto, Yoshiaki Shirato, Massaki Matsushima
  • Patent number: 4053209
    Abstract: An electrochromic device for use in a display apparatus which is basically constructed with an electrochromic layer containing therein a metal oxide compound, an auxiliary electrochromic layer containing therein at least one kind of metal compound which contains at least one kind of metal element, wherein the difference in electro-negativity between the metal element in the metal compound and the metal element contained in the metal oxide constituting the electrochromic layer is 0.4 or less, both the electrochromic layer and the auxiliary electrochromic layer being laminated, and a pair of electrodes holding between them the laminated electrochromic layer and auxiliary electrochromic layer, at least one of the pair of electrodes being light transmissive.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: November 26, 1975
    Date of Patent: October 11, 1977
    Assignee: Canon Kabushiki Kaisha
    Inventors: Toshitami Hara, Yoshioki Hajimoto, Yoshiaki Shirato, Masaaki Matsushima
